Pro Tips

How to Choose the Right Bare Metal Provider: 6 Key Criteria to Consider

Rackdog Team

cloud and bare metal latency compared

As cloud costs rise and workload demands grow, more teams are exploring infrastructure alternatives. 

For those that have landed on bare metal as their answer, leasing physical servers from a provider offers a practical way to avoid the overhead of procuring and managing hardware.

If that’s your path, the difference between finding a dependable infrastructure partner and setting yourself up for a move you regret comes down to choosing the right bare metal provider.

But with many providers in the market, it can be overwhelming to sort through your options and separate real make-or-break differences from noise.

This guide aims to make the decision a bit easier, breaking it down into six criteria that matter most when choosing a bare metal provider (including a few that often get overlooked). 

1. Infrastructure reliability (stability, containment, and recovery)

A bare metal server is only as good as it is dependable. Naturally, reliability is a great place to start your evaluation. 

Most bare metal providers will advertise a 99.99% uptime SLA. It’s a useful baseline, but with that claim increasingly seen as table stakes in the industry, it's worth diving a layer deeper to validate how a provider intends to deliver on that promise. 

To get a clearer picture, evaluate a provider’s reliability across three areas: baseline stability, containment, and recovery. 

Baseline stability 

This represents the consistency of performance under normal conditions, before any failures or edge cases. It’s defined by the core components of the environment:

  • Is the provider using modern hardware like current CPUs, ECC RAM, and NVMe? 

  • Do they have the upstream connectivity and peering needed to keep latency low and routing efficient? 

  • Is the network provisioned with enough capacity, or is it oversubscribed? 

  • Are the data centers they operate in well-run, with reliable power and cooling?

Most providers will clear this bar, but you’ll occasionally run into some who cut corners. The more transparent a provider can be with this information, the better.

Containment 

This reflects how well a provider limits the impact of failures. When something goes wrong, does the issue stay isolated or spread?

To assess this, look for redundancy and isolation in the network and rack design. Do they have multiple upstream carriers with automatic traffic rerouting? Is switching and power redundant at the rack level?

Ideally, failures should affect a path or a single server, not multiple systems, keeping issues small and recovery faster.

Recovery 

This reflects how quickly the environment can be restored after an issue.

Recovery is shaped by both the provider’s support and the level of control you have. Strong providers offer responsive, technically capable support that can diagnose and resolve issues without unnecessary back-and-forth.

At the same time, direct access like IPMI or KVM allows your team to step in immediately for tasks like reboots, reinstalls, or troubleshooting.

2. Hardware and network performance

Consistent performance is a primary reason teams move to bare metal, so it’s important to verify a provider can deliver on those expectations.

When evaluating performance, look at both the hardware and the network. Both need to hold up in order to ensure a server can deliver the performance your workload requires, across throughput, latency, and I/O.

From a hardware perspective, insist on transparency. A provider should be able to specify the exact CPU, RAM, and storage you’re getting, including model and generation. That makes it possible to determine whether the server is aligned to the needs of your specific workload, whether you’re optimizing for clock speed, core count, or I/O.

Then investigate the network, going beyond surface-level claims. A 10Gbps port doesn’t guarantee you can push 10Gbps consistently. Check how the network is provisioned. Is there enough capacity behind the ports, or is it oversubscribed? Does the provider disclose their upstream carriers, routing, and overall network capacity?

3. Scalability across workloads and regions

Infrastructure needs aren’t static. As traffic grows, workloads evolve, or new regions come online, your environment needs to scale without introducing new constraints.

Ask about provisioning speed. When additional capacity is needed, how quickly can it be deployed? Strong providers offer ready-to-deploy servers that can be provisioned in minutes, along with short lead times for custom configurations.

Then determine how well the provider supports larger configurations. As workloads grow, you may need more CPU, memory, or storage per node. A provider should support higher-performance builds and allow you to scale up as needed.

Also, make sure a provider can deliver the horizontal scale you may need. It’s one thing to deploy a few servers. It’s another to operate dozens or hundreds with consistency. Even if your initial deployment is small, it’s a good idea to verify that a provider can support scaling to larger deployments without introducing delays or inconsistency.

Finally, think about geographic scale. If your workload expands into new regions, you may run into new latency sensitivities or compliance considerations that weren’t relevant at the start. Does the provider have data center locations to meet current and future needs? 

4. Pricing transparency and predictability

Different providers use different pricing models. Some charge hourly, others monthly, and some offer discounts for longer-term or higher-volume commitments. 

What matters is understanding what the list price actually includes. It’s common for a server to be advertised at one price, only for the real monthly cost to increase once add-ons are factored in. Things like ports, IPs, or support tiers can change the total quickly if they’re not clearly defined upfront.

Bandwidth is another key area to evaluate. Some providers charge for outbound data transfer, often referred to as egress fees. If your workload pushes a high volume of traffic, these costs can add up quickly. In those cases, it’s important to understand any thresholds, overage rates, or limits before committing.

Other providers offer flat-rate pricing with unmetered bandwidth, and no egress fees, which can make costs easier to predict as usage grows.

5. Support quality and responsiveness

When issues come up, or when you’re making changes, the quality of a provider’s support directly affects how quickly you can move.

Start by verifying how a provider handles technical support. Is it purely ticket-based, or can you get direct access to someone when you need it? Response time matters, but so does the quality of the response. You want engineers who can diagnose and resolve issues, not just route tickets.

Beyond troubleshooting, consider how engaged the provider is willing to be before and after deployment. Are they available to talk through migration plans, onboarding, or architecture? Do they offer guidance, or are you expected to figure things out on your own?

For some teams, support also includes the option to offload operational work. Managed services offered by the provider can take a variety of infrastructure-related tasks off your team’s plate, if that’s a need you’ve identified. 

6. Ease of integration and management

For most engineering teams, infrastructure works best when it stays out of the way and doesn’t add friction or constraints.

For cloud-native teams moving to bare metal, this comes down to how well the provider fits into existing workflows. Can infrastructure be managed the same way as cloud resources, or does it introduce manual steps and new processes?

Look for API access and Terraform support so servers can be provisioned and managed as part of your infrastructure-as-code workflows. Without that, routine changes can add unnecessary overhead and slow your team down.

The bottom line: Do we feel good about this provider as a long-term partner? 

It may seem subjective or trivial, but this matters just as much as anything you’ll find in a spec sheet. After all, you’re not just choosing infrastructure, you’re choosing a provider you’ll rely on to keep your systems running smoothly. 

Before committing, pay attention to how a prospective provider approaches the client relationship: 

  • How responsive has the provider been during the evaluation process?

  • Are answers clear and transparent, or do they require follow-up to get specifics?

  • Do they take an interest in your specific use case, or treat every deployment the same?

  • Do their priorities around performance, pricing, and support align with what your team values?

These are early signals of what it will be like to work with them once you’re up and running.

It’s also worth thinking long term. Infrastructure providers have a track record of venturing into new offerings, then deprecating them as priorities shift. Before making a commitment, it’s a good idea to be sure the provider you choose is stable, focused, and committed to the type of infrastructure you’re deploying. 

Final takeaway

Choosing a bare metal server provider is an important decision, and one that benefits from a comprehensive evaluation. By understanding your requirements and vetting providers across the criteria outlined here, you’re more likely to find a stable, long-term home for your workloads.

If you’re currently weighing options, Rackdog’s team of infrastructure engineers is available to help. We encourage you to test our bare metal servers against the criteria in this guide, along with any others that matter to your team. 

Rackdog is a global infrastructure provider with a core focus on bare metal, delivered with the convenience of the cloud. Across 12+ global locations, teams rely on Rackdog for consistent performance, predictable costs, and scalable infrastructure solutions.

Build with us

Ready to deploy your first server in seconds?